Yeah I've spent many thousand miles behind the wheel of LCs, and I think my expectation from the IS 500 is that it'd drive like a four-door variant of that, and as a daily I handily prefer a four-door. The LC does drive brilliantly but I think it was moreso the interior quality (LC feels bespoke) and the suspension. I tracked my IS 500 once and the suspension calibration wasn't where I'd like it to be.
